摘要: 1.nginx负载均衡 网站的访问量越来越大,服务器的服务模式也得进行相应的升级,比如分离出数据库服务器、分离出图片作为单独服务,这些是简单的数据的负载均衡,将压力分散到不同的机器上。有时候来自web前端的压力,也能让人十分头痛。怎样将同一个域名的访问分散到两台或更多的机器上呢?这其实就是另一种负载 阅读全文
posted @ 2018-03-21 22:06 桃子不在 阅读(124) 评论(0) 推荐(0) 编辑
摘要: 基于JDK1.7.0_80与JDK1.8.0_66做的分析 JDK1.7中 使用一个Entry数组来存储数据,用key的hashcode取模来决定key会被放到数组里的位置,如果hashcode相同,或者hashcode取模后的结果相同(hash collision),那么这些key会被定位到Ent 阅读全文
posted @ 2018-03-21 22:01 桃子不在 阅读(122) 评论(0) 推荐(0) 编辑
摘要: 为了建立冗余较小、结构合理的数据库,设计数据库时必须遵循一定的规则。在关系型数据库中这种规则就称为范式。范式是符合某一种设计要求的总结。要想设计一个结构合理的关系型数据库,必须满足一定的范式。 在实际开发中最为常见的设计范式有三个: 1.第一范式(确保每列保持原子性) 第一范式是最基本的范式。如果数 阅读全文
posted @ 2018-02-26 15:51 桃子不在 阅读(82) 评论(0) 推荐(0) 编辑
摘要: Java集合类主要由两个接口派生而出:Collection和Map 从上面的集合框架图可以看到,Java集合框架主要包括两种类型的容器,一种是集合(Collection),存储一个元素集合,另一种是图(Map),存储键/值对映射。Collection接口又有3种子类型,List、Set和Queue,再下面是一些抽象类,最后是具体实现类,常用的有ArrayList、LinkedList、H... 阅读全文
posted @ 2018-02-25 19:50 桃子不在 阅读(367) 评论(0) 推荐(0) 编辑
摘要: Object是所有类的父类,任何类都默认继承Object。Object类到底实现了哪些方法? 1.clone方法 保护方法,实现对象的浅复制,只有实现了Cloneable接口才可以调用该方法,否则抛出CloneNotSupportedException异常。 2.getClass方法 final方法 阅读全文
posted @ 2018-02-23 09:20 桃子不在 阅读(16399) 评论(0) 推荐(0) 编辑
摘要: 在使用spring mvc中,绑定页面传递时间字符串数据给Date类型是出错: Failed to convert property value of type [java.lang.String] to required type [java.util.Date] for property 'ex 阅读全文
posted @ 2018-01-31 16:21 桃子不在 阅读(279) 评论(0) 推荐(0) 编辑
摘要: 1、Integer是int的包装类,int则是java的一种基本数据类型 2、Integer变量必须实例化后才能使用,而int变量不需要 3、Integer实际是对象的引用,当new一个Integer时,实际上是生成一个指针指向此对象;而int则是直接存储数据值 4、Integer的默认值是null 阅读全文
posted @ 2018-01-20 16:40 桃子不在 阅读(173) 评论(0) 推荐(0) 编辑
摘要: 一、hashmap底层实现原理 二、多线程实现方式 三、什么是线程安全 四、Synchrnized锁 五、api接口实现 六、排序,堆排序、快速排序的实现 七、设计模式 单例模式(饱汉与饿汉) 八、TCP三次握手、四次挥手 阅读全文
posted @ 2017-12-14 22:11 桃子不在 阅读(408) 评论(0) 推荐(0) 编辑
摘要: 毫无经验的一次面试,笔经面经全没过,也未曾复习,狠狠的摔了一跤! 一、有关栈的插入、查询要求编写代码(数据结构) 二、TCP、UDP区别(转载http://zhangjiangxing-gmail-com.iteye.com/blog/646880) TCP(Transmission Control 阅读全文
posted @ 2017-12-14 21:49 桃子不在 阅读(251) 评论(2) 推荐(0) 编辑